What Documents Are Required for Property Handover?
The handover process begins with crucial documentation. Essential papers include:
-
Signed lease agreement or property deed
-
Property condition report with photos
-
Utility transfer documents
-
Building access cards or keys
-
Warranty information for appliances
-
Building rules and regulations
-
Insurance documentation
How to Conduct a Thorough Apartment Handover Inspection?
A detailed apartment handover inspection should cover all aspects of the property:
-
Test all electrical outlets and switches
-
Check plumbing fixtures for leaks
-
Verify heating and cooling systems
-
Inspect windows and doors for proper operation
-
Document wall conditions and paint quality
-
Test all built-in appliances
-
Examine floor conditions and any damage

How to Document Property Condition During Handover?
Proper documentation prevents future disputes:
-
Take date-stamped photographs
-
Record video walkthroughs
-
Note existing damage or wear
-
Get both parties to sign condition reports
-
Keep copies of all documentation
-
Create detailed inventory lists
-
Document meter readings
What Are Critical Safety Checks During Property Handover?
Safety should be a top priority during handover:
-
Verify smoke detector functionality
-
Check carbon monoxide detectors
-
Test security systems
-
Ensure fire exits are accessible
-
Confirm emergency lighting works
-
Review evacuation procedures
-
Inspect electrical safety certificates
-
Verify gas safety records
